Overview

History

The New Mexico Rail Runner Express was inaugurated on July 14, 2006, as a strategic initiative to provide a reliable and efficient mass transit option for the residents of central New Mexico.

Operated by Rio Metro Regional Transit District, the Rail Runner was designed to alleviate traffic congestion, reduce travel times, and offer an environmentally friendly alternative to driving. The service has since become an integral part of the region's transportation network.

The Route

The Rail Runner's route covers roughly 97 miles, stretching from Belen in the south to Santa Fe in the north. The journey takes travelers through diverse landscapes and key urban centers, including Albuquerque. Here are the stations along the route:

1. **Belen**: The southern terminus, serving the town of Belen and its surrounding communities.

2. **Los Lunas**: A convenient stop for residents of Los Lunas.

3. **Isleta Pueblo**: Serving the Isleta Pueblo community.

4. **Bernalillo County/International Sunport**: Close to Albuquerque International Sunport for easy airport access.

5. **Downtown Albuquerque**: Located in the heart of Albuquerque, offering connections to buses and other forms of transit.

6. **Montaño**: Serving the northern area of Albuquerque.

7. **Los Ranchos/Journal Center**: Near the Journal Center business complex.

8. **Sandia Pueblo**: Serving the Sandia Pueblo community.

9. **Downtown Bernalillo**: A convenient stop for the residents of Bernalillo.

10. **Sandoval County/US 550**: Serving the northern part of Bernalillo and nearby communities.

11. **Kewa Pueblo**: Serving the Kewa Pueblo community.

12. **Santa Fe County/NM 599**: Near the State Highway 599, serving southern Santa Fe County.

13. **South Capitol**: Serving central Santa Fe, with easy access to state government offices.

14. **Santa Fe Depot**: The northern terminus, located in downtown Santa Fe near cultural and historical attractions.

Schedule and Frequency

The Rail Runner operates seven days a week, including holidays, with more frequent service during peak hours on weekdays to accommodate commuters. Weekend schedules are relaxed, catering to leisure travelers and tourists. For the most up-to-date schedule, visit the Rio Metro Regional Transit District website or use the Rail Runner mobile app.

Planning Your Trip

Ticket Options

The Rail Runner offers a variety of ticket options to suit different travel needs:

1. **One-Way and Round-Trip Tickets**: Ideal for occasional travelers.

2. **Day Passes**: Providing unlimited travel for a single day, perfect for tourists and sightseers.

3. **Monthly Passes**: Designed for regular commuters, offering unlimited travel for a month.

4. **Annual Passes**: Available for frequent travelers who prefer the convenience of a yearly pass.

Purchasing Tickets

Tickets can be purchased through several convenient methods:

1. **Rail Runner Mobile App**: Available for iOS and Android, the app allows you to buy and use digital tickets on your smartphone.

2. **Ticket Vending Machines (TVMs)**: Located at all Rail Runner stations, accepting cash, credit, and debit cards.

3. **Online**: Purchase tickets via the Rail Runner website and print them at home.

Fares and Discounts

The Rail Runner operates a zone-based fare system, with pricing dependent on the number of zones traveled. Discounts are available for:

1. **Seniors (60+)**: Reduced fares for senior citizens.

2. **Youth (ages 10-17)**: Discounted fares for young passengers.

3. **Children (under 10)**: Ride free when accompanied by a fare-paying adult.

4. **Persons with Disabilities**: Reduced fares for eligible passengers with disabilities.

5. **Students**: Specific discounts available for college and university students with a valid ID.

Fare Zones

Fares are calculated based on the number of zones traveled. The Rail Runner service area is divided into several zones, with each zone representing a segment of the route. Traveling through more zones increases the fare. Refer to the Rail Runner website for a detailed fare chart and zone map.

At the Station

Arrival and Boarding

Plan to arrive at your station at least 15-30 minutes before your train’s scheduled departure. This allows time for purchasing tickets, finding the correct platform, and boarding.

Digital displays and audio announcements provide information about train arrivals, departures, and any service changes. Be sure to check the platform number and board the correct train.

Parking and Accessibility

Many Rail Runner stations offer parking facilities, with spaces available on a first-come, first-served basis. Some stations also offer paid parking for extended stays. Stations are equipped with facilities to accommodate passengers with disabilities, including ramps, elevators, and accessible restrooms.

Bicycles and Luggage

The Rail Runner is bicycle-friendly, with designated bike racks available on each train. Passengers are encouraged to bring only what they can carry, storing personal items in overhead racks or under seats. Bikes should be secured in the designated areas to ensure safety and accessibility for all passengers.

Onboard Experience

Seating and Comfort

Rail Runner trains feature comfortable seating arranged in a mix of two-by-two and four-by-four configurations.

Seats are spacious, with ample legroom and large windows offering panoramic views of New Mexico's stunning landscapes.

For a quieter journey, try to find a seat in designated quiet zones where loud conversations and noise are discouraged.

Amenities and Services

The Rail Runner provides several amenities to enhance your travel experience:

1. **Wi-Fi**: Complimentary Wi-Fi is available on board for browsing, email, and social media.

2. **Power Outlets**: Power outlets are available at various seating locations for charging electronic devices.

3. **Restrooms**: At least one car on each train is equipped with clean and modern restrooms.

4. **Accessibility**: Trains are designed to accommodate passengers with disabilities, offering accessible seating and restrooms.

5. **Bicycle Racks**: Secure racks are available for cyclists to store their bikes during the journey.

Exploring Destinations

Belen

Belen, known as "The Hub City," offers a rich history and a vibrant community. Key attractions include:

1. **Harvey House Museum**: Learn about the Fred Harvey Company and the impact of the railroad on New Mexico.

2. **Belen Art League Gallery and Gifts**: Discover local art and unique gifts crafted by New Mexico artists.

Los Lunas

Los Lunas is a growing community with various recreational opportunities. Visit:

1. **Los Lunas Museum of Heritage & Arts**: A museum showcasing the history and culture of Valencia County.

2. **Tome Hill Park**: A scenic spot popular for hiking and offering panoramic views of the surrounding area.

Albuquerque

Albuquerque is the largest city in New Mexico, offering a blend of modern amenities and rich cultural heritage. Key attractions include:

1. **Old Town Albuquerque**: A historic district with shops, restaurants, and museums.

2. **ABQ BioPark**: Home to the zoo, aquarium, botanical garden, and Tingley Beach.

3. **Sandia Peak Tramway**: Take a scenic tram ride to the top of Sandia Peak for breathtaking views.

4. **Indian Pueblo Cultural Center**: Learn about the history, culture, and art of New Mexico's Pueblo communities.

Bernalillo

The town of Bernalillo offers a mix of cultural heritage and outdoor activities. Explore:

1. **Coronado Historic Site**: Discover the ruins of Kuaua Pueblo and artifacts from the Coronado expedition.

2. **Santa Ana Star Casino**: Enjoy gaming, dining, and entertainment options.

Santa Fe

Santa Fe, the state capital, is known for its Pueblo-style architecture, vibrant arts scene, and rich history. Key attractions include:

1. **Santa Fe Plaza**: The historic heart of the city, surrounded by shops, restaurants, and cultural sites.

2. **Georgia O'Keeffe Museum**: Dedicated to the life and work of the renowned artist.

3. **New Mexico Museum of Art**: Featuring a diverse collection of Southwestern art.

4. **Loretto Chapel**: Famous for its miraculous spiral staircase.

5. **Meow Wolf**: An immersive art installation that offers a unique, interactive experience.

6. **Canyon Road**: A picturesque street lined with art galleries, boutiques, and cafes.
